﻿body {
background-color:#fc9017;
color:#666666;
height:100%;
margin:0;
padding:0;
text-align:center;
font-family:Arial,'sans-serif';
font-size:14px;
}
a {
color:#074793;
text-decoration:none;
}
a:hover {
text-decoration:none;
}
a.selected {
color:#074793;
}
form {
margin:0;
padding:0;
}
h1,h2 {
margin:0;
padding:10px 0 0 0;
}
h3,h4 {
margin:0;
padding:0;
}
img, a img {
border:0 none;
}
img.centered {
vertical-align:middle;
}
input {
background-color:#ffffff;
border:1px solid #aaccee;
padding:2px;
}
input.button, input.buttonGo, input.buttonBack {
border-left:1px solid #cccccc;
border-right:1px solid #666666;
border-top:1px solid #cccccc;
border-bottom:1px solid #666666;
color:#ffffff;
font-weight:bold;
margin:0;
padding:3px 9px;
cursor:pointer;
}
input.button {
background-color:#186bb5;
}
input.buttonBack {
background-color:#606060;
}
input.buttonGo {
background-color:#299807;
}
input.fieldDate {
width:70px; 
}
input.fieldText {
width:150px; 
}
input.fieldText100 {
width:200px; 
}
input.fieldText255 {
width:300px; 
}
input.fieldTextSmall {
width:75px; 
}
input.fieldTextTwo {
width:25px; 
}
textarea {
background-color:#ffffff;
border:1px solid #aaccee;
font-family:arial,'sans-serif';
width:300px; 
}
textarea.textWide {
width:400px; 
}
#page {
height:100%;
margin-bottom:0;
margin-top:0;
margin-left:auto;
margin-right:auto;
position:relative;
text-align:left;
width:832px;
}
#pageContentTabs {
font-weight:bold;
margin:0;
padding:10px 0 0 0;
vertical-align:middle;
}
#pageContentTabs span {
font-size:28px;
}
#pageContentTabs img {
padding:0 5px;
vertical-align:middle;
}
.pageReturn {
clear:right;
float:right;
height:16px;
line-height:16px;
padding-left:14px;
padding-bottom:10px;
padding-top:5px;
}
.signIn {
color:#666666;
float:right;
height:89px;
line-height:89px;
}
.signIn img {
vertical-align:middle;
}
#signInButton {
cursor:pointer;
}
.altRow {
background-color:#efefef;
}
.centered {
text-align:center;
}
.explicitLink {
text-decoration:underline;
}
.dateOpen {
color:#299807;
}
.dateList,.dateListNarrow {
border:1px solid #8eb6db;
font-size:13px;
height:460px;
overflow-x:hidden;
overflow-y:auto;
margin-bottom:10px;
}
.dateList {
width:481px;
}
.dateListNarrow{
width:348px;
}
.dateList table {
width:481px;
}
.dateListNarrow table {
width:348px;
}
.dateList table tr td {
padding:3px 0 3px 1px;
}
.dateListButtons {
font-weight:bold;
white-space:nowrap;
width:121px;
}
.dateListDate {
width:117px;
}
.dateListMeal {
overflow:hidden;
width:213px;
}
.fineprint {
color:#666666;
font-size:12px;
font-style:italic;
}
.fieldLabel {
font-weight:bold;
text-align:right;
}
.fieldLabelCell {
font-weight:bold;
text-align:right;
width:150px;
}
.floatedButton {
float:right;
}
.genericButtons {
height:16px;
line-height:16px;
padding:5px 0;
}
.imageIsland {
clear:right;
float:right;
padding:10px;
}
.infobox {
width:32px;
}
.label {
font-weight:bold;
}
.header, .header1, .header2 {
font-weight:bold;
margin:0;
padding:10px 0;
}
.header {
font-size:19px;
}
.header1 {
font-size:17px;
}
.header2 {
font-size:15px;
}
.lightedText {
color:#fc9017;
}
.panelCleared {
clear:both;
}
.panelFull {
background-color:#ffffff;
border:1px solid #fc9017;
padding:5px;
}
.panelGeneric {
margin-bottom:5px;
}
.panelHolder {
float:left;
width:483px;
}
.panelHolderSide {
border:1px solid #cfcfcf;
clear:right;
float:right;
margin-bottom:5px;
margin-left:5px;
padding:6px;
width:278px;
}
.panelPadded {
background-color:#ffffff;
margin:0;
padding:0 40px 0 40px;
}
.panelShaded {
background-color:#efefef;
border:1px solid #8eb6db;
margin-bottom:10px;
padding:5px;
}
.pageQandA h3 {
color:#2a73b8;
}
.regular {
font-size:12px;
}
.roLink {
color:#074793;
}
.spacer {
clear:both;
margin:0;
padding:0;
}
.subText {
color:#666666;
}
.error {
color:#ff0000;
font-weight:bold;
margin:0;
padding:0;
}
.inactive {
color:#cccccc;
}
.success {
color:green;
font-weight:bold;
}
.textError {
color:Red;
}
.textSmaller {
font-size:12px;
}
.textLarger {
font-size:15px;
}